When Batman is injured saving Superman, he doubts his worth without powers—until Superman takes him to Kandor, a city where neither of them has super abilities, to rediscover what it means to be a hero. In this quiet, character-driven moment, the two icons confront vulnerability, trust, and the strength found in partnership.

In "Luthor et Brainiac (1ère partie - Le sinistre duo)," Lex Luthor, newly escaped from prison, uncovers the long-lost alien menace Brainiac and reprograms him into a loyal ally. Together, the duo devises a plan to shrink Superman, setting off a high-stakes confrontation that draws in the Kandorians and the legacy of Brainiac’s ancient lineage.
